AGEN 104 - Estate And Small Farm Equipment Operation

Institution:
SUNY Morrisville (formerly Morrisville State College)
Subject:
Description:
This course will familiarize the student with safe and proper methods of operating, performing maintenance, managing and selecting equipment in an economically viable way. Equipment covered will include stationary and mobile machines such as auxiliary power units and equipment found on small farms and horticultural applications. It does not include the in-depth study into any specific machine, but covers the basics. 2 credits (1 lecture hour, 3 laboratory hours), fall semester
